So yeah, anything about Final Fantasy! I guess this would make a good starting point: Which are your favorite games in the series and why?

My two all-time favorites are tied between Final Fantasy V and Final Fantasy IX. They're both very fun games that don't take themselves too seriously while still being legitimately emotional. On top of that, Zidane is my favorite Final Fantasy lead in the entire series. He's light-hearted, fun, and a generally nice guy to be around. FFV also has the advantage of having one of, if not the best, Job System in an FF game. Both FFV and FFIX make characters customizable while keeping them all unique in their own way. I'm also very fond of Final Fantasy I; it hasn't aged well, but it's classic, and like FFV, I played it tons as a kid.

Technically stuff like One Winged Angel and Caius' Theme are also vocal tracks but they are "different" in my head if you get me.

The difference is tracks like "One-Winged Angel" and "Caius's Theme" are choir tracks, which are sung by multiple people, simultaneously, and they also tend to just be the same two or three lines repeated. Choir vocals are more like an extension of the music itself, as opposed to tracks like "Noel's Theme" and "Dragonsong", which have just one singer front-and-center, and more elaborate lyrics.
